PostgreSQL是一款功能强大且流行的关系型数据库管理系统,它支持多种操作系统,包括Windows。以下是如何在Windows上部署 PostgreSQL数据库的步骤。
步骤1:下载和安装PostgreSQL
首先,请访问PostgreSQL官方网站,下载适合你的Windows版本的 PostgreSQL安装包(.zip或.exe)。以下是使用.exe安装包的步骤:
- 下载完成后,请双击打开exe文件。
- 单击“下一步”直到出现“选择安装位置”的界面,选择一个需要写入数据的磁盘分区。通常情况下,C:\Program Files\PostgreSQL[版本号]是合适的。
- 单击“下一步”,选择“启动服务”并勾选“创建桌面快捷方式和开始菜单项”。
或者,您也可以使用.zip包安装PostgreSQL:
- 下载完成后,请解压缩到一个合适的目录,如C:\Program Files\PostgreSQL[版本号]。
- 然后,进入解压后的文件夹,找到
postgresql-[版本号]-bin.zip
,解压缩到相同的目录。 - 将
initdb.exe
和pg_ctl.exe
等可执行文件复制到PostgreSQL程序目录中。
步骤2:配置PostgreSQL
-
创建超级用户:打开命令行(如cmd),并进入PostgreSQL bin目录(例如:C:\Program Files\PostgreSQL[版本号 ]\bin)。然后使用以下命令创建一个超级用户:
initdb -D C:\ProgramData\PostgreSQL\pgdata pg_ctl start -w -D C:\ProgramData\PostgreSQL\pgdata psql -d postgres -U postgres -c "ALTER ROLE postgres WITH PASSWORD '你的密码';"
-
配置环境变量:在系统的环境变量中添加以下值:
- PATH:添加C:\Program Files\PostgreSQL[版本号]\bin
- PGDATA:添加C:\ProgramData\PostgreSQL\pgdata
步骤3:启动PostgreSQL服务
- 在命令行输入
psql -U postgres -d postgres
,登录到Postgres数据库。 - 输入
\q
退出。
现在,您已经成功安装并配置了PostgreSQL数据库。您可以使用pgAdmin或者其他图形用户界面的工具来管理和访问您的数据库。
注意:
- 确保你的Windows版本支持64位PostgreSQL。如果不是,请下载相应的32位版。
- 选择合适的磁盘分区作为数据存储位置,以避免写入问题。
推荐阅读
如果您是刚开始使用PostgreSQL,或者需要更多相关信息,以下是一些推荐的资源:
- [PostgreSQL官方文档](www.postgresql.org/docs/manual…
- [pgAdmin教程](www.pgadmin.org/docs/)